Check Your Adsense Earnings From Your Desktop With Adsense Alert

Adsense Alert is a freeware utility that sits on your desktop notification area updating itself every 20 minutes with how much Adsense money you have made today. It always check my Adsense earnings whenever I surf internet. This tool will save my time as I don’t need to login every time to check my Adsense earnings.

Instead of retrieving your Adsense earnings, it also do a couple of other things, for a start it lets you set up to 5 daily goals. When each of these is passed you can have the program pop-up a notification (like an e-mail alert), play a sound or even e-mail you with your current total.

This application requires PC running on MS Windows XP or Vista with .net framework version 2 installed.
